Setting the Sky-High Scene

Transforming the celebration space into a mini airfield is the first step in creating an aviation-themed adventure. Imagine a backdrop of fluffy clouds, hanging airplanes, and banners emblazoned with the birthday pilot’s name. With a color palette inspired by the sky—blues, whites, and pops of red—it’s time to set the stage for an unforgettable journey.

Personalized Boarding Pass Invitations

The adventure begins with personalized boarding pass invitations that set the tone for the aviation-themed celebration. Include playful phrases like “Ready for Takeoff” and provide essential flight details, building anticipation for the soaring festivities.

The Flight Crew: Aviator Attire for All

Encourage little aviators to dress the part by donning aviator hats, scarves, and goggles. The birthday child can shine as the captain in a specially designed pilot’s uniform. This not only adds a touch of authenticity to the celebration but also creates an immersive experience for all young passengers.

DIY Cloud Decorations

Crafting DIY cloud decorations enhances the sky-high ambiance. Hang cotton ball clouds from the ceiling to create a three-dimensional sky effect. Add paper airplanes and hanging propellers to complete the aviation-inspired decor. The result is a space that transports young adventurers into the vast blue yonder.

In-Flight Entertainment: Activities to Soar

An aviation-themed birthday adventure demands in-flight entertainment that captures the imagination of young pilots.

Paper Airplane Station

Set up a paper airplane station where little aviators can craft and customize their own planes. Challenge them to see whose airplane can travel the farthest. This activity not only fuels creativity but also provides a hands-on experience of the magic of flight.

Sky-High Culinary Delights

Elevate the celebration with culinary delights that reflect the aviation theme. Consider an airplane-shaped cake adorned with fluffy clouds or cupcakes decorated with edible propellers. Sky-blue beverages and cloud-shaped cookies add an extra touch of whimsy to the in-flight menu.

Aviation Snack Buffet

Create an aviation-themed snack buffet featuring “fuel-up” snacks like pretzel propellers, cloud cotton candy, and gummy airplanes. Label each snack with playful aviation-inspired names like “Jet Fuel Jellybeans” and “Cloud Nine Cupcakes” to enhance the thematic experience.

Aviation Adventure Photo Ops

Capture the joy and excitement of the aviation adventure with photo ops that transport young pilots into the clouds.

Airplane Photo Booth

Set up an airplane photo booth with props like pilot hats, aviator glasses, and airplane wings. Encourage guests to strike their best aviation-themed poses, creating a gallery of memories for both the birthday child and their co-pilots.

Party Favors for Future Aviators

Send young aviators home with party favors that extend the magic of the aviation adventure.

DIY Mini Airport

Create DIY mini airports as party favors, complete with miniature airplanes, runway strips, and cloud-shaped candies. These little souvenirs serve as reminders of the high-flying adventure and spark imaginative play beyond the celebration.

Reflecting on the Journey

As the aviation-themed third birthday adventure comes to an end, take a moment to reflect on the incredible journey. Capture the magic in a scrapbook filled with photos, mementos, and messages from the little aviators who joined in the celebration.

Flight Log Keepsake

Consider creating a flight log keepsake where guests can leave messages, drawings, or well wishes for the birthday pilot. This personalized logbook becomes a cherished memento, capturing the spirit of the aviation-themed adventure for years to come.
